Float too large to pack with f format

WebDec 15, 2024 · The rule of thumb is to have at least 10 times as many files as there will be hosts reading data. At the same time, each file should be large enough (at least 10 MB+ and ideally 100 MB+) so that you can benefit from I/O prefetching. For example, say you have X GB of data and you plan to train on up to N hosts. Web1 day ago · If the string passed in to pack () is too long (longer than the count minus 1), only the leading count-1 bytes of the string are stored. If the string is shorter than count-1, it is padded with null bytes so that exactly count bytes in all are used.

tables - LaTeX: Float too large warning - TeX - Stack Exchange

WebDec 31, 2024 · I need to pack some pivots into UV and then my shader can read them. I need to pack 4 float3 into a float4. Therefore, I need to pack each float3 into a float. These 4 float3 are (model space position1, direction1, model space position2, direction2). I know how to handle the directions because they are normalized. WebStructural pattern matching in Python 3.10. September 2024. Summary: Python 3.10, which is due out in early October 2024, will include a large new language feature called structural pattern matching. This article is a critical but (hopefully) informative presentation of the feature, with examples based on real-world code. duties of security guard in resume https://desdoeshairnyc.com

format — Python Reference (The Right Way) 0.1 documentation

WebMar 20, 2024 · If you pass the values in as a float, you will lose your values accuracy after packing. This is because C floats are less accurate than Python floats. 1 2 3 4 import struct f = open('file.bin', 'wb') value = 1.23456 data = struct.pack ('f',value) Printing this data would result in 1.2345600128173828 Instead of, data = struct.pack ('f',value) WebNov 27, 2012 · The following error seems to trip up the proxy with in a few minutes of running. What is the cause? Is it because my longitude has a negative in it? … WebSep 17, 2005 · I get an OverflowError: long int too large to convert to int ioctl() is expecting a 32-bit integer value, and 0xc0047a80 has the high-order bit set. I'm assuming Python thinks it's a signed value. How do I tell Python that 0xc0047a80 is an unsigned 32-bit value? In 2.3 and before, you get this: 0xc0047a80 -1073448320 crystal bar resorts world

struct — Interpret bytes as packed binary data — Python 3.11.3 ...

Category:Everything You Should Know About Python struct.pack ()

Tags:Float too large to pack with f format

Float too large to pack with f format

Everything You Should Know About Python struct.pack ()

WebApr 23, 2024 · LaTeX Warning: Float too large for page by 2.38557pt on input line 339. I can't see anything wrong with the figures in the output document, but it makes the compilation output harder to read because it is full of such warnings. ... In contrast to actually changing the dimensions of an offending image or float, which is too tall and/or too wide ... WebOct 2, 2015 · Converting floating point numbers to fixed point integers is an error prone idea, due to floats covering much larger magnitudes. Say unpacking sRGB will give you pow(255,2.2) values, which are larger than 0xffff, and you will need several times than …

Float too large to pack with f format

Did you know?

WebDec 15, 2024 · import struct def pack_float (my_float: float) -> bytes: return struct.pack (' float: unpacked_float = struct.unpack_from (' WebDec 26, 2024 · LaTeX Warning: Float too large for page by 18.73247pt on input line 1125. simply means, that a float (in your case the table) is to long to fit completly on one page. …

Web2 days ago · In decimal floating point, 0.1 + 0.1 + 0.1 - 0.3 is exactly equal to zero. In binary floating point, the result is 5.5511151231257827e-017. While near to zero, the differences prevent reliable equality testing and differences can accumulate. For this reason, decimal is preferred in accounting applications which have strict equality invariants. WebJul 11, 2024 · The example converts the packed value to a sequence of hex bytes for printing with binascii.hexlify (), since some of the characters are nulls. $ python struct_pack.py Original values: (1, 'ab', 2.7) Format string : I 2s f Uses : 12 bytes Packed Value : 0100000061620000cdcc2c40. If we pass the packed value to unpack (), we get …

http://python-reference.readthedocs.io/en/latest/docs/functions/format.html WebIf the value to pack is too long, the result is truncated. If it's too long and an explicit count is provided, Z packs only $count-1 bytes, followed by a null byte. Thus Z always packs a trailing null, except when the count is 0. Likewise, the b and B formats pack a string that's that many bits long. Each such format generates 1 bit of the result.

Web1 day ago · For the 'f', 'd' and 'e' conversion codes, the packed representation uses the IEEE 754 binary32, binary64 or binary16 format (for 'f', 'd' or 'e' respectively), regardless of the …

WebRepresentation issues are orthogonal to the OP's issue which is really just a simple rounding example: >>> x = float.fromhex('0x0.1234560000001') >>> unpack('!f', pack('!f', x))[0].hex() '0x1.2345600000000p-4' Also, if something like the suggested note is adopted, it needs to be worded in a way that doesn't imply that the struct implementation ... crystal bar pendant lightWebAn alternative would be to scale values in the range (FLT_MAX, 2.0 * FLT_MAX] by 0.5 before doing the conversion, something like this: if (fabs(x) > FLT_MAX && … crystal bar vanity lightWebWhen packing a float that's too large for the destination format (e.g. pack (">f", 1e39)): - before the patch, _PyFloat_Pack* gives an OverflowError on non-IEEE-754 platforms … crystal baranekWebSep 25, 2024 · The format string '>f' means 'f' IEEE 754 binary32 (4 bytes, like a C float) '>' big-endian byte order, standard size That's documented here. The characters @ and ` are just part of your numeric data (3.5) when represented as ASCII. It's probably more helpful to look at these 4 bytes represented as binary: duties of security officerWebMar 31, 2012 · This post implements a previous post that explains how to convert 32-bit floating point numbers to binary numbers in the IEEE 754 format. What we have is some C++ / Java / Python routines that will allows us to convert a floating point value into it’s equivalent binary counterpart, using the standard IEEE 754 representation consisting of … duties of senior warden episcopal churchWebMar 20, 2024 · Packing/Unpacking Float using struct.pack() If you’re packing Python float values as binary using .pack(), you should keep in mind that the C language calls Python … duties of security guard in canadaWebOverflowError: float too large to pack with f format. After a few seconds of streaming data, pyNatNat crashes. Here is the verbose output: Beginning: … crystal baransi